Start with a clear plan

A practical rear extension begins with understanding how the added space will be used. List your goals—more living room space, a larger kitchen, a dedicated dining area, or flexible rooms for work and hobbies. From there, map circulation routes, natural light needs, and how the new layout connects to existing rooms. Check permissions and design constraints

Before work starts, verify what approvals may be required. Many rear extensions involve planning and building control considerations, especially where boundaries, access, or design impact nearby properties. Structural changes also require careful checks, including load paths, floor support, and roof design. If your home has existing constraints—limited rear access for deliveries, party wall considerations, or older foundations—plan for them early to avoid delays and rework.

Workmanship that protects performance

For a durable result, focus on build quality and on-site coordination. Good practice includes accurate setting-out, proper damp-proofing details, airtightness measures, and high-performance insulation to reduce heat loss. Windows and doors should be installed with careful sealing and alignment to prevent drafts. Roofing and guttering must be detailed to handle water runoff reliably. Electrical and plumbing routes need to be planned so finishes remain neat and serviceable.
